Boy Scout Troop 468 was chartered with Trinity United Methodist Church on February 28, 1963 and serves the young men in the Milford Miami Township area of Clermont County, Ohio. Although we are chartered by a religious institution, the troop itself is non-sectarian and membership is open to young men ages 11 to 17 (inclusive), of any faith, race or national origin who follow the ideas of the Scout Oath and Law.

Meetings

Troop 468 meets on Monday night from 7:00 - 8:30 pm
In the Fellowship Hall at
Trinity United Methodist Church
5767 Wolfphen-Pleasant Hill Rd.
Milford, OH 45150

The Fellowship Hall generally is opened by 6:30 pm. Scouts are welcome to come early to hold patrol meetings, meet with Merit Badge Counselors and take part in some pre-meeting activities. Boy leaders and patrols responsible for skill lessons are encouraged to be at the meetings by 6:45 pm to prepare for the night's meeting. When at troop meetings Boy Scout Field Uniform is expected to be worn unless otherwise directed by the Senior Patrol Leader. Please check the troop calendar for specific dates.
